Hibiki 17 Year Old Kacho Fugetsu is a limited edition of Suntory’s 17-year blend, presented in the house’s 24-facet decanter under chrysanthemums and red-crowned cranes. Kacho Fugetsu — 花鳥風月, flower, bird, wind, moon — is the classical Japanese phrase for the beauty of nature, and the decoration is its subject. Its weight now comes from what happened to the whisky inside: Suntory withdrew Hibiki 17 from its core range in September 2018 amid a shortage of aged stock. This page claims no release year and no edition size — the trade record contradicts itself on both.

The Elemental Distinction

01

The chrysanthemum — Japan’s imperial flower — and the red-crowned crane decorate both the decanter and its gold carton; the pairing is a long-standing motif of longevity and good fortune in Japanese art.

02

Kacho Fugetsu (花鳥風月) reads literally as flower, bird, wind, moon — the classical shorthand for the beauty of nature, and the edition’s stated theme.

03

The 24-facet decanter is Hibiki’s house form, its facets corresponding to the 24 sekki divisions of the traditional Japanese calendar.

04

Hibiki 17 was withdrawn from Suntory’s core range from September 2018, alongside Hakushu 12, when demand outran aged stock — the company called the withdrawal temporary and has not restored it to the core lineup.

05

The Hibiki range draws malt from the Yamazaki and Hakushu distilleries and grain from Chita, and debuted in 1989 — the producer’s own description of the blend’s architecture.

06

No release year or edition size is claimed. Sellers date this edition inconsistently (2015 and 2016) and quote unverified run figures; no producer record resolves either.

Production Methodology

Hibiki has been Suntory’s blended range since 1989, built on malt from the Yamazaki and Hakushu distilleries and grain from Chita, and presented in a 24-facet decanter whose facets answer to the 24 sekki of the traditional calendar. This edition takes the 17-year expression and decorates that decanter, and its gold carton, with chrysanthemums and red-crowned cranes under the title Kacho Fugetsu. What gives the bottle its present standing is a separate event: in May 2018 Suntory confirmed that Hibiki 17 and Hakushu 12 would be withdrawn owing to supply constraints on aged whisky, with Hibiki 17 leaving the core range from that September. The company framed the withdrawal as temporary and apologised for it; the expression has not returned to the core lineup. Beyond that, this page stops: the edition’s release year, its size, and the technique behind the decoration are all reported inconsistently by sellers and by no producer source that survives checking.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does Kacho Fugetsu mean?

Kacho Fugetsu — written 花鳥風月 — reads literally as flower, bird, wind, moon. It is a classical Japanese phrase for the beauty of the natural world and for the contemplation of it, and it is the stated theme of this edition, whose decanter and carton carry chrysanthemums and red-crowned cranes.

Is Hibiki 17 still in production?

No. In May 2018 Suntory confirmed that Hibiki 17 Year Old and Hakushu 12 Year Old would be withdrawn because demand had outrun the supply of aged whisky, with Hibiki 17 leaving the core range from that September. The company described the withdrawal as temporary and apologised for it, but the expression has not returned to the core lineup — so remaining bottles draw on a finite pool.

How many bottles of the Kacho Fugetsu edition were made, and when was it released?

Midnight Whiskey does not state either, because neither is verifiable. Sellers date the edition to 2015 and to 2016 — one listing gives both years in a single paragraph — and quote runs of 600 and of fewer than 1,000, with one source hedging its own figure as 'probably'. No producer record settles it. Rather than repeat the most common version, this page describes what can be established and says plainly what cannot.
